Have you heard of Movember? My husband participates every year. Basically it is a fundraiser that happens during the duration of November where people raise money for prostate cancer research. One way that people raise awareness is by growing out their mustaches all month long. Oh now it rings a bell? You DID notice all the funny ‘staches right around the holidays?
Anyway, it is a great way for individuals and companies to support the cause. While my husband will get friends and family to donate, many companies donate a percentage of their proceeds of sales. One of these companies is Fuzzy Ink. (They donate $5 from each sale to the Movember Foundation!)
